Winemaking and Aging

The Franciacorta Extra Brut Rosé DOCG 2021 - Barone Pizzini is primarily made from Pinot Noir grapes vinified as a rosé using the saignée method, which involves a brief maceration on the skins that gives the wine its delicate color and refined aromatic profile. This is followed by aging on the lees in the bottle for about 30 months, during which the wine acquires complexity and finesse. The Extra Brut disgorgement preserves the freshness and expressive purity of the fruit.

Storage and Aging: How to store Franciacorta Extra Brut Rosé DOCG 2021 - Barone Pizzini

To preserve the personality of this Franciacorta, it is important to store it in a cool place, away from light and temperature fluctuations, preferably with the bottle lying down to keep the cork moist. The Franciacorta Extra Brut Rosé DOCG 2021 - Barone Pizzini best expresses its character within 1-2 years of disgorgement, a period when freshness and liveliness reach their peak. Subsequently, it may evolve slightly towards more complex notes, but it is recommended to enjoy it young to fully appreciate its brilliant energy and elegant fragrance.
